存储卡乱码现象背后的技术真相
近年来,“一卡2卡3卡4卡乱码”问题频繁引发用户困惑,尤其在摄影、监控、移动设备领域,存储卡因乱码导致数据丢失的情况屡见不鲜。这种现象表面看似随机错误,实则与存储设备底层逻辑密切相关。专业研究表明,乱码多由文件系统损坏、物理存储单元异常或设备兼容性冲突引发。例如,FAT32/exFAT文件系统在非正常拔出时,分配表可能被破坏,导致操作系统无法正确解析文件结构,从而显示为“�”或乱码字符。此外,多卡槽设备(如监控录像机)若未统一格式化标准,不同品牌存储卡混用时,固件兼容性问题也会触发乱码连锁反应。
乱码成因深度解析:从物理到逻辑层的多重隐患
存储卡乱码的核心原因可分为四大类:**物理损坏**、**文件系统错误**、**病毒攻击**和**接口接触不良**。物理层面,NAND闪存芯片的坏块积累会导致数据写入异常;逻辑层面,分区表损坏或主引导记录(MBR/GPT)错误会直接扰乱文件索引。实验数据显示,约35%的乱码案例源于用户强制中断数据传输,导致文件系统未完成写入操作。更隐蔽的风险来自恶意软件——某些病毒会篡改文件头信息,伪装成乱码以逃避查杀。此外,高速SD卡(如UHS-II)在低版本读卡器上运行时,因电压不稳定也可能出现临时性乱码。
实战教程:三步修复乱码并挽救数据
遭遇乱码时切勿盲目格式化!首先通过**磁盘检测工具**(如HD Tune)扫描存储卡健康状态,排除物理损坏可能。第二步使用**CHKDSK命令**(Windows)或**fsck**(Mac/Linux)修复文件系统错误,命令示例:`chkdsK /f X:`(X为盘符)。若仍无法解决,可借助专业数据恢复软件(如R-Studio、Disk Drill)提取原始数据。进阶方案需使用十六进制编辑器分析扇区数据,定位损坏的簇链并手动重建文件结构。值得注意的是,多卡设备需确保所有存储卡采用相同格式(建议exFAT),并定期使用厂商工具(如SD Formatter)进行深度维护。
预防乱码的终极指南:硬件与软件的协同优化
预防胜于治疗!选择存储卡时需关注**速度等级认证**(如V30、A2),工业级产品具备ECC纠错和磨损均衡技术,可将乱码概率降低70%。设备端应开启“安全移除硬件”流程,避免热插拔导致缓存数据丢失。对于关键数据存储,建议启用RAID 1镜像模式,多卡实时备份。软件开发层面,推荐采用具有校验机制的传输协议(如SFTP),并在应用程序中集成异常中断恢复功能。实验证明,定期执行`TRIM`指令优化闪存区块,可有效延长存储卡寿命并减少逻辑错误发生。